>>94003645The thing about phasing is, its modifes the state of existence for the card, not a changing of zones. As Out of Time has never left the battlefield, it is just phased out. There is a way to undo it, but its hyper specific.

>>94004010What green "ramp" are you talking about, dipshit? Three Visits, Farseek, Cultivate, etc... all provide less mana than they cost. Mana dorks don't tap the turn they come into play, and the most popular ones are one-drops that tap for one.Getting more mana than you started with is called "fast mana", by the way, and is generally red and black (Seething Song and Dark Ritual, for example). "Ramp" is a permanent increase mana production, letting you "ramp up" over the course of several turns.
